✂ answer key — fold or cut before handing out

1-B   2-B   3-B   4-B  |  5 = elevation   6 = clipped/untappable   7 = Apple HIG favors depth, blur, and content-first minimalism; Material Design uses elevation, bold color, and motion to show hierarchy   8 = Because each platform's users already expect that specific convention from every other app on their device   9 = Small targets are easy to miss or mis-tap, especially for users with larger fingers or motor impairments, leading to frustration and errors  |  10 = iOS: rely on an edge-swipe gesture plus a small back chevron in the top-left; Android: a visible back arrow icon in the top app bar plus support for the system back button/gesture.
